Saturday, June 22 – Sunday, June 30
Coming off a victory at historic Rickwood Field in Birmingham, Alabama, the Cardinals return to Busch Stadium to open a nine-game homestand over the next nine days. The club continues its current three-game series with two games against the San Francisco Giants (June 22-23), followed by three contests with the Atlanta Braves (June 24-26), and concludes with a four-game weekend series against the Cincinnati Reds (June 27-30).

2024 MLB ALL-STAR BALLOT – VOTE NOW
Fans can cast their votes for the nine Cardinals players on the 2024 MLB All-Star Ballot presented by BuildSubmarines.com now at cardinals.com/vote or via the MLB app.
Voting will take place in two phases. During the first phase of voting from June 5-27, fans can submit up to five ballot submissions per email address during any 24-hour period. The top overall vote getter in each League will automatically earn starting roster spots in their designated positions. For the remaining positions, the top two players for each infield position and the designated hitter position, along with the top four players in the outfield positions, will remain on the ballot for the second phase of voting from June 30-July 3.
The 2024 MLB All-Star Game presented by Mastercard will be held on Tuesday, July 16, at Globe Life Field in Arlington, TX.
